一、中转服务器核心架构
中转服务器基于TCP/IP协议栈构建,包含三个核心组件:请求接收模块、路由决策模块和数据转发模块。其工作流程遵循四层网络模型:网络接口层处理物理连接,网络层管理IP寻址,传输层实现TCP/UDP会话控制,应用层执行协议解析。
二、服务器搭建流程
典型部署环境需要完成以下步骤:
- 硬件配置:选择双网卡服务器,建议内存≥8GB,配置SSD存储阵列
- 操作系统安装:推荐CentOS 8+或Ubuntu 20.04 LTS,需关闭非必要服务
- 网络设置:配置静态IP地址和子网掩码,示例配置:
网卡配置示例 网卡 IP地址 网关 ens33 192.168.1.100 192.168.1.1 ens36 10.0.0.1 – - 安装转发组件:通过
yum install ipvsadm
加载LVS内核模块
三、TCP/IP转发机制
数据转发流程包含五个阶段:
- 三次握手建立客户端连接(SYN→SYN-ACK→ACK)
- 请求报文解析与目标地址重写
- 连接状态跟踪表维护(包含源IP、目标IP、端口映射)
- 响应报文逆向路由
- FIN-ACK四次挥手终止会话
四、负载均衡配置策略
在LVS架构中实现负载均衡需要配置:
算法类型 | 响应时间 | 适用场景 |
---|---|---|
轮询(Round Robin) | 100-200ms | 服务器性能均等 |
加权最小连接 | 50-150ms | 异构服务器集群 |
关键配置命令示例:ipvsadm -A -t 192.168.5.100:80 -s rr
ipvsadm -a -t 192.168.5.100:80 -r 10.0.0.2:80 -m
现代中转服务器通过四层网络协议栈实现高效数据转发,结合LVS等工具可构建高可用集群。实际部署需注意网络隔离、会话保持和健康检查机制,推荐采用双活架构保证服务连续性。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/422774.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。